March 18, 2024 12:25 PM EDTFisker (NYSE: FSR) stock is down again Monday, falling a further 12% after the company said it would pause production for six weeks starting the week of March 18.
The electric vehicle company also announced a new financing commitment from an existing investor, providing up to $150 million of gross proceeds.

March 18, 2024 7:57 AM EDT(Reuters) -Fisker said on Monday it would pause production of its electric vehicles for six weeks and raise up to $150 million in funding by selling convertible notes as the startup tries to navigate a cash crunch and weak demand for its cars.
